The Role
The Chassis Controls Performance Engineer has responsibility for the leading development and tuning direction of the Chassis Controls System for a given vehicle, vehicle platform and involvement across the particular architecture. Chassis Controls includes the anti-lock braking system (ABS), the Traction Control System, the Yaw Stability Control System (Stabilitrack), All Wheel Drive or 4 Wheel Drive controls, and Vehicle Mode Controls.
What You'll Do
You'll be responsible to define performance requirements, and lead the integration of the controls with the HiL, vehicle hardware and software to achieve these requirements. This includes some or all of the following specific tasks:
  • Develop vehicle level implementation of chassis control subsystems - anti-lock brakes (ABS), Traction Control, Stability Control Systems (yaw stability), All Wheel Drive or 4 Wheel Drive controls.
  • Integrate the control systems with each other and with the vehicle hardware and software. Work with controls system supplier engineers to adapt systems to the car.
  • Lead, Mentor & execute the design of the vehicle development test plan and material to support it - calendar, events, milestones, test vehicles, locations, supplier scheduling, development parts, and demonstrations.
  • Lead defining system requirements and then tune control systems with supplier to achieve the vehicle performance requirements.
  • Create and apply models (MATLAB or other) to determine system performance and interactions analytically to guide hardware development as applicable.
  • Lead, mentor and execute applying test procedures with vehicle on artificial and real road surfaces to determine vehicle system performance and optimize system interactions. Perform snow and ice handling evaluations, traction evaluations, handling evaluations including evasive maneuvers, brake stopping distance evaluations. This includes dry pavement, wet, ice, snow, sand, gravel, and dirt.
  • Set up vehicle measurement instrumentation and execute measurements as required during development to guide process. Interpret data. Measure vehicle as part of the validation of car to requirements - both mvss (federal) and global and internal.
  • Complete Validation and required reporting for each variant
  • Demonstrate vehicle performance of controls systems to management and media
  • Initiate documents to provide engineering authority for design group and suppliers to execute design, calibration, software.
  • Exhibit leadership amongst cross functional team in working with engineering functions, suppliers, plant personnel and others to implement cost reduction, methods and product improvements, and to support build programs
  • Support assembly plant at start of production as required
  • Stay abreast of new technology and competitive products

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
